North Central Vietnam, Vietnam

Money-Saving Strategies

Ninh Binh does not have common tourist discount cards or passes for its attractions. Entrance fees are generally paid individually at each site.

Free Activities and Attractions

  • Cycling through rice paddies and villages is a free activity, especially if your homestay offers complimentary bicycle rental.
  • Bich Dong Pagoda entrance is generally free.
  • Some tourist-oriented restaurants in Tam Coc may offer happy hour deals.

Transportation Savings

  • Rent a bicycle for the cheapest way to get around the flat areas.
  • Renting a scooter offers more flexibility and is cost-effective for solo travelers or pairs.
  • Use Grab (the ride-sharing app) for fixed fares to avoid overcharging.
  • Take the train or public bus from Hanoi to Ninh Binh.

Accommodation Alternatives

  • Homestays and guesthouses represent excellent value compared to larger hotels or resorts.
  • Many include breakfast and bicycle rentals, further reducing expenses.
  • Inquire about packages that bundle activities or meals.
  • Look for options outside the immediate tourist hotspots for potentially lower prices.

Time-Saving Tips

Efficiently manage your time to see more of Ninh Binh's wonders.

Attraction Timing

  • Skip-the-line options are not generally necessary; lines are manageable.
  • Visit Trang An or Tam Coc boat trips and Mua Cave early morning (before 9 AM).
  • Late afternoon (after 3 PM) offers fewer crowds and better light for photography.

Efficient Routing

  • Group attractions geographically for better time management.
  • Tam Coc, Bich Dong, and Mua Cave are close to each other.
  • Trang An and Hoa Lu Ancient Capital are relatively close, making them efficient to visit together.
  • Plan your route to minimize travel between sites.

Local Insights

Understand local customs and avoid common tourist pitfalls for a smoother experience.

Common Tourist Mistakes

  • Always agree on a price for taxis, xe om (motorbike taxis), or goods before making a purchase.
  • Carry small bills; many vendors might not have change for large denominations.
  • If renting a scooter, have an International Driving Permit with a motorcycle endorsement and wear a helmet.
  • Check your travel insurance policy regarding motorbike accidents.

Unofficial Rules and Social Norms

  • Honking is common and signals presence, not anger.
  • Locals might stare out of curiosity; a smile is a warm response.
  • Public displays of affection are generally avoided.
  • Bargain politely in markets.

Local Customs to Know

  • Respect elders.
  • Remove your shoes before entering homes or temples.
  • Use both hands when giving or receiving items.
  • Smile often.

Phrases that Impress Locals

  • "Cảm ơn" (Thank you).
  • "Ngon quá!" (Delicious!) when eating.
  • "Tôi không biết tiếng Việt" (I don't speak Vietnamese).

Emergency & Medical Information

Emergency Numbers & Contacts

Direct Services

  • Police: 113
  • Fire: 114
  • Ambulance: 115
  • Tourist Support: Your local homestay or hotel staff.

Hospital Locations

  • Ninh Binh Provincial General Hospital (Bệnh viện Đa khoa tỉnh Ninh Bình).
  • Smaller clinics and pharmacies are available throughout the city.
  • For serious medical emergencies, transfer to Hanoi's international hospitals is recommended.
  • Carry any personal medical information.

Lost Document Procedures

  • Report lost documents to local police immediately.
  • Obtain a police report.
  • Contact your embassy or consulate for assistance with replacement travel documents.
  • Most foreign embassies and consulates are in Hanoi.

Documentaries & Films

Visual Journeys

  • "Kong: Skull Island" (2017) famously shot scenes in Trang An and Tam Coc.
  • The film displays the region's dramatic landscape.

Natural Disaster Protocols

Monitoring & Guidance

  1. Monitor local weather forecasts, especially during monsoon and typhoon season (June to October).
  2. Follow advice from local authorities.
  3. Heed guidance from your accommodation regarding safety procedures.
  4. Be aware of potential evacuation plans.
  5. Stay informed through reliable news sources.

Staying Safe

  1. Identify emergency exits at your accommodation.
  2. Know the location of designated safe areas if available.
  3. Keep emergency contacts readily accessible.
  4. Maintain a supply of bottled water and any necessary medications.
  5. Avoid outdoor activities during severe weather warnings.

Pre-Trip Checklist

Essential Preparations

Months Before

  • Passport Validity

    Your passport must be valid for at least six months beyond your intended return date from Vietnam.

  • Visa Requirements

    Research visa requirements for your nationality and apply for an e-visa or visa approval letter if needed. Do this early to allow for processing time.

  • International Flights

    Book international flights, especially if traveling during peak season, to acquire better fares and preferred timings.

Month Before

  • Accommodations

    Book your accommodations in Ninh Binh. Popular homestays and resorts fill up, especially during high season.

  • Travel Insurance

    Purchase travel insurance. It covers medical emergencies, trip cancellations, and any planned activities.

  • Itinerary & Packing

    Start researching specific activities and building a flexible itinerary. Begin preparing your packing list based on the climate and activities.
